With the increasing internet penetration rate, IoT is finding applications in retail, consumer electronics, agriculture, automotive, transportation, and other verticals. The continuously increasing number of Internet users worldwide is expected to drive the demand for high-speed, low-cost IoT technology-based devices such as radio frequency identification (RFID) tags, barcode scanners, and mobile computers. This would result in an increased demand for sensors.
The IoT revolution is transforming industries, and sensors are at the heart of this change. From monitoring critical parameters to enabling intelligent automation, IoT sensors empower businesses to make faster, data-driven decisions.
𝗧𝗵𝗲 𝗺𝗮𝗿𝗸𝗲𝘁 𝘀𝗽𝗮𝗻𝘀 𝗮 𝘃𝗮𝗿𝗶𝗲𝘁𝘆 𝗼𝗳 𝘀𝗲𝗻𝘀𝗼𝗿 𝘁𝘆𝗽𝗲𝘀:
• Pressure
• Temperature
• Humidity
• Image
• Inertial
• Gyroscope
• Touch
These sensors operate over wired and wireless networks, forming the backbone of both Industrial IoT (IIoT) and Commercial IoT applications.
In Industrial IoT, sensors enable predictive maintenance, process optimization, and operational efficiency. In Commercial IoT, they drive smart buildings, retail analytics, and environmental monitoring.
